Going for a scan can save your life
Men over 60, you have a silent time bomb ticking inside you.
I did. Professor Naylor and the vascular surgery department at Leicester Royal Infirmary and their screening programme found I had an aneurysm of the aorta in 2005. It measured 2.7cm.
Over seven years it had grown and a few days ago I had to go to the infirmary for a small operation.
The operation went well thanks to Prof Naylor and his surgery team, the nursing staff in the recovery ward and the wonderful nursing staff on ward 21.

Thank you for all the care and attention you gave me.
If I had not gone along to the screening programme at my health centre, in Ashby, I would never have known I had the aneurysm.
During the seven years it took to grow to 6.2cm this year, I had no symptoms. You do not know you have one until you have a scan.
Let the aneurysm burst and it spells disaster for you.
Please, if you are a man in this age group and have not had a scan, go to your doctor and arrange to have one. It only takes five minutes and it could save your life.
We are very lucky in Leicestershire to have one of the top hospitals specialising in vascular surgery, run by Prof Naylor.
Save a life – have a scan.
Mike Pratt, Ashby.
